Position Summary:

As part of the Human Resources Team at Georgia Aquarium, Volunteer Programs supports our large, diverse volunteer population. The Volunteer Programs Specialist engages with volunteers and staff to coordinate the program's daily operations, addressing both volunteer and organizational needs. This role supports recruitment, onboarding, recognition, and retention for the general volunteer program, teen volunteers, interns, and employee volunteers.

Success in this role requires strong attention to detail, the ability to build trust-based relationships with a large and diverse volunteer population, and the capacity to manage multiple overlapping projects while meeting deadlines. All Volunteer Programs team members work weekends as part of their regular schedule.

Responsibilities:
  • Provide day-to-day support and guidance to general volunteers, teen volunteers, interns, and employee volunteers across all program areas.
  • Develop and implement volunteer engagement, retention, and recognition strategies that strengthen the overall volunteer experience and encourage long-term commitment.
  • Manage reward processing and ordering for volunteers, including uniforms, tickets, incentives, and passes, ensuring timely and equitable fulfillment.
  • Serve as a primary point of contact for prospective and active volunteers, reviewing applications, answering questions, and processing volunteer paperwork, payments, and background screenings.
  • Coordinate and facilitate all volunteer onboarding, including information sessions and orientation, ensuring a consistent and professional experience for all new volunteers.
  • Support the training and development of volunteers by facilitating the mentor/mentee program and coordinating ongoing learning opportunities that build volunteer skills and program knowledge
  • Plan and execute volunteer engagement initiatives and appreciation events, including monthly office activities, Volunteer Appreciation Week, and the annual Volunteer Appreciation Event.
  • Maintain accurate, up-to-date volunteer records, files, and position descriptions, creating new volunteer positions as needed and conducting periodic audits to ensure data integrity and compliance with organizational standards.
  • Collaborate with Aquarium departments to ensure clear understanding of how the Volunteer Programs team supports the overall Georgia Aquarium Strategic Plan; support the broader HR Team as needed.
  • Maintain confidentiality of sensitive volunteer information and ensure compliance with applicable regulations, including background screening requirements and labor laws; monitor regulatory changes and recommend policy or procedural updates as needed.
  • Perform other duties as workload necessitates.
